Mastromarchi P, McLean S, Ali N, May S. Effects of matched vs. unmatched physical therapy interventions on pain or disability in patients with neck pain - a systematic review and meta-analysis. Physiother Theory Pract 2023:1-20. [PMID: 38037765 DOI: 10.1080/09593985.2023.2285892]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/24/2023] [Accepted: 11/09/2023] [Indexed: 12/02/2023]
Abstract
BACKGROUND The interventions performed in most randomized controlled trials (RCTs) on neck pain patients are standardized, irrespective of the high heterogeneity of patients. However, clinicians tend to choose an intervention based on the patients' clinical characteristics, and thus match the treatment to the patient. OBJECTIVES To investigate the effectiveness of interventions matched to the clinical characteristics of patients with neck pain versus the same, but unmatched treatment for improving pain or disability. DESIGN A systematic review and meta-analysis conducted following Cochrane guidelines. METHODS Databases searches were performed from inception to September 2023. RCTs were included if the patients in the experimental group received a treatment matched to clinical presentation or to clinicians' assessment, if the patients in the control group received a similar but unmatched treatment, and if pain or disability were reported as outcome measures. RESULTS The literature search produced 9516 records of which 27 met the inclusion criteria. Matched exercise therapy was superior to unmatched exercise for pain (SMD -0.57; 95% CI -0.95, -0.18) and for disability (SMD -0.69; 95% CI -1.14, -0.23) at short term, but not at intermediate-term follow-up. Matched manual treatment was not superior to unmatched manual therapy for pain or for disability at short or intermediate-term follow-up. CONCLUSIONS Results suggest that matching exercise to movement limitation, trapezius myalgia, or forward head position may lead to better outcomes in the short term, but not in the intermediate-term. Matched manual therapy was not superior to unmatched treatment either short or intermediate-term. Further research is warranted to verify if those criteria are potentially useful matching criteria.

Bini P, Hohenschurz-Schmidt D, Masullo V, Pitt D, Draper-Rodi J. The effectiveness of manual and exercise therapy on headache intensity and frequency among patients with cervicogenic headache: a systematic review and meta-analysis. Chiropr Man Therap 2022; 30:49. [PMID: 36419164 PMCID: PMC9682850 DOI: 10.1186/s12998-022-00459-9] [Citation(s) in RCA: 8]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/02/2022] [Accepted: 11/01/2022] [Indexed: 11/25/2022] Open
Abstract
BACKGROUND Cervicogenic headache is a secondary headache, and manual therapy is one of the most common treatment choices for this and other types of headache. Nonetheless, recent guidelines on the management of cervicogenic headache underlined the lack of trials comparing manual and exercise therapy to sham or no-treatment controls. The main objective of this systematic review and meta-analysis was to assess the effectiveness of different forms of manual and exercise therapy in people living with cervicogenic headache, when compared to other treatments, sham, or no treatment controls. METHODS Following the PRISMA guidelines, the literature search was conducted until January 2022 on MEDLINE, CENTRAL, DOAJ, and PEDro. Randomized controlled trials assessing the effects of manual or exercise therapy on patients with cervicogenic headache with headache intensity or frequency as primary outcome measures were included. Study selection, data extraction and Risk of Bias (RoB) assessment were done in duplicate. GRADE was used to assess the quality of the evidence. RESULTS Twenty studies were included in the review, with a total of 1439 patients. Common interventions were spinal manipulation, trigger point therapy, spinal mobilization, scapulo-thoracic and cranio-cervical exercises. Meta-analysis was only possible for six manual therapy trials with sham comparators. Data pooling showed moderate-to-large effects in favour of manual therapy for headache frequency and intensity at short-term, small-to-moderate for disability at short-term, small-to-moderate for headache intensity and small for headache frequency at long-term. A sensitivity meta-analysis of low-RoB trials showed small effects in favor of manual therapy in reducing headache intensity, frequency and disability at short and long-term. Both trials included in the sensitivity meta-analysis studied spinal manipulation as the intervention of interest. GRADE assessment showed moderate quality of evidence. CONCLUSION The evidence suggests that manual and exercise therapy may reduce headache intensity, frequency and disability at short and long-term in people living with cervicogenic headache, but the overall RoB in most included trials was high. However, a sensitivity meta-analysis on low-RoB trials showed moderate-quality evidence supporting the use of spinal manipulation compared to sham interventions. More high-quality trials are necessary to make stronger recommendations, ideally based on methodological recommendations that enhance comparability between studies. Trial registration The protocol for this meta-analysis was pre-registered on PROSPERO under the registration number CRD42021249277.

Núñez-Cabaleiro P, Leirós-Rodríguez R. Effectiveness of manual therapy in the treatment of cervicogenic headache: A systematic review. Headache 2022; 62:271-283. [PMID: 35294051 DOI: 10.1111/head.14278] [Citation(s) in RCA: 8]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/01/2021] [Revised: 01/09/2022] [Accepted: 01/11/2022] [Indexed: 12/20/2022]
Abstract
OBJECTIVE The aim of this study was to identify the manual therapy (MT) methods and techniques that have been evaluated for the treatment of cervicogenic headache (CH) and their effectiveness. BACKGROUND MT seems to be one of the options with the greatest potential for the treatment of CH, but the techniques to be applied are varied and there is no consensus on which are the most indicated. METHODS A systematic search in Scopus, Medline, PubMed, Cinahl, PEDro, and Web of Science with the terms: secondary headache disorders, physical therapy modalities, musculoskeletal manipulations, cervicogenic headache, manual therapy, and physical therapy. We included articles published from 2015 to the present that studied interventions with MT techniques in patients with CH. Two reviewers independently screened 365 articles for demographic information, characteristics of study design, study-specific intervention, and results. The Oxford 2011 Levels of Evidence and the Jadad scale were used. RESULTS Of a total of 14 articles selected, 11 were randomized control trials and three were quasi-experimental studies. The techniques studied were: spinal manipulative therapy, Mulligan's Sustained Natural Apophyseal Glides, muscle techniques, and translatory vertebral mobilization. In the short-term, the Jones technique on the trapezius and ischemic compression on the sternocleidomastoid achieved immediate improvements, whereas adding spinal manipulative therapy to the treatment can maintain long-term results. CONCLUSIONS The manual therapy techniques could be effective in the treatment of patients with CH. The combined use of MT techniques improved the results compared with using them separately. This review has methodological limitations, such as the inclusion of quasi-experimental studies and studies with small sample sizes that reduced the generalizability of the results obtained.

The Unknown Prevalence of Postrandomization Bias in 15 Physical Therapy Journals: A Methods Review. J Orthop Sports Phys Ther 2021; 51:542-550. [PMID: 34546817 DOI: 10.2519/jospt.2021.10491] [Citation(s) in RCA: 8] [Impact Index Per Article: 2.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/07/2023]
Abstract
OBJECTIVES To determine the prevalence of prospective clinical trial registration and postrandomization bias in published musculoskeletal physical therapy randomized clinical trials (RCTs). DESIGN A methods review. LITERATURE SEARCH Articles indexed in MEDLINE and published between January 2016 and July 2020 were included. STUDY SELECTION CRITERIA Two independent blinded reviewers identified the RCTs using Covidence. We included RCTs related to musculoskeletal interventions that were published in International Society of Physiotherapy Journal Editors member journals. DATA SYNTHESIS Data were extracted independently for the variables of interest from the identified RCTs by 2 blinded reviewers. The data were presented descriptively or in frequency tables. RESULTS One hundred thirty-eight RCTs were identified. One third of RCTs were consistent with their prospectively registered intent (49/138); consistency with prospectively registered intent could not be determined for two thirds (89/138) of the RCTs. Four RCTs (8%)reported inconsistent results with the primary aims and 7 (14%) with the outcomes from the prospective clinical trial registry, despite high methodological quality (Physiotherapy Evidence Database [PEDro] scale score). Differences between prospectively registered and non-prospectively registered RCTs for PEDro scale scores had a medium effect size (r = 0.30). Two of 15 journals followed their clinical trial registration policy 100% of the time; in 1 journal, the published RCTs were consistent with the clinical trial registration. CONCLUSION Postrandomization bias in musculoskeletal physical therapy RCTs could not be ruled out, due to the lack of prospective clinical trial registration and detailed data analysis plans. Price J, Rushton A, Tyros V, Heneghan NR. Expert consensus on the important chronic non-specific neck pain motor control and segmental exercise and dosage variables: An international e-Delphi study. PLoS One 2021; 16:e0253523. [PMID: 34197481 PMCID: PMC8248695 DOI: 10.1371/journal.pone.0253523]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/08/2021] [Accepted: 06/07/2021] [Indexed: 12/26/2022] Open
Abstract
BACKGROUND Chronic non-specific neck pain is highly prevalent, resulting in significant disability. Despite exercise being a mainstay treatment, guidance on optimal exercise and dosage variables is lacking. Combining submaximal effort deep cervical muscles exercise (motor control) and superficial cervical muscles exercise (segmental) reduces chronic non-specific neck pain, but evaluation of optimal exercise and dosage variables is prevented by clinical heterogeneity. OBJECTIVE To gain consensus on important motor control and segmental exercise and dosage variables for chronic non-specific neck pain. METHODS An international 3-round e-Delphi study, was conducted with experts in neck pain management (academic and clinical). In round 1, exercise and dosage variables were obtained from expert opinion and clinical trial data, then analysed thematically (two independent researchers) to develop themes and statements. In rounds 2 and 3, participants rated their agreement with statements (1-5 Likert scale). Statement consensus was evaluated using progressively increased a priori criteria using descriptive statistics. RESULTS Thirty-seven experts participated (10 countries). Twenty-nine responded to round 1 (79%), 26 round 2 (70%) and 24 round 3 (65%). Round 1 generated 79 statements outlining the interacting components of exercise prescription. Following rounds 2 and 3, consensus was achieved for 46 important components of exercise and dosage prescription across 5 themes (clinical reasoning, dosage variables, exercise variables, evaluation criteria and progression) and 2 subthemes (progression criteria and progression variables). Excellent agreement and qualitative data supports exercise prescription complexity and the need for individualised, acceptable, and feasible exercise. Only 37% of important exercise components were generated from clinical trial data. Agreement was highest (88%-96%) for 3 dosage variables: intensity of effort, frequency, and repetitions. CONCLUSION Multiple exercise and dosage variables are important, resulting in complex and individualised exercise prescription not found in clinical trials. Future research should use these important variables to prescribe an evidence-informed approach to exercise.

Measuring upper limb disability for patients with neck pain: Evaluation of the feasibility of the single arm military press (SAMP) test. Musculoskelet Sci Pract 2020; 50:102254. [PMID: 32932051 DOI: 10.1016/j.msksp.2020.102254]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/15/2020] [Revised: 08/27/2020] [Accepted: 09/01/2020] [Indexed: 11/20/2022]
Abstract
BACKGROUND Non-specific neck pain (NSNP) is frequently associated with upper limb disability (ULD). Consequently, evaluation of ULD using an outcome measure is necessary during the management of patients with NSNP. The Single Arm Military Press (SAMP) test is a performance-based ULD measure developed for populations with neck pain. During the SAMP test, patients are asked to repeatedly lift a weight above their head for 30 s. The number of repetitions is counted. Its clinical utility in a patient group is still unknown. OBJECTIVE This study investigates the feasibility of the SAMP test from patients and clinicians' perspectives. METHODS Seventy female patients with NSNP were randomly allocated into one of three groups. Participants in each group completed the SAMP test using one of three proposed weights (½kg, 1 kg or 1½kg). The feasibility of the SAMP test was established using structured qualitative exit feedback interviews for patients and administrating clinicians. RESULTS Participants using ½kg achieved the highest number of repetitions, but a high proportion reported the weight as extremely light, whereas those who tested using the 1½kg achieved the lowest number of repetitions and participants reported the weight as being heavy. Participants tested using 1 kg achieved an average number of repetitions and a high proportion reported the weight as acceptably heavy. Clinicians and patients reported that the SAMP test was efficient and convenient. CONCLUSION The 1 kg SAMP test is feasible for use in female patients with NSNP. The measurement properties of the SAMP test should be determined in a patient group.

Chi-Lun-Chiao A, Chehata M, Broeker K, Gates B, Ledbetter L, Cook C, Ahern M, Rhon DI, Garcia AN. Patients' perceptions with musculoskeletal disorders regarding their experience with healthcare providers and health services: an overview of reviews. Arch Physiother 2020; 10:17. [PMID: 32983572 PMCID: PMC7517681 DOI: 10.1186/s40945-020-00088-6] [Citation(s) in RCA: 8]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/23/2020] [Accepted: 09/15/2020] [Indexed: 12/21/2022] Open
Abstract
Objectives This overview of reviews aimed to identify (1) aspects of the patient experience when seeking care for musculoskeletal disorders from healthcare providers and the healthcare system, and (2) which mechanisms are used to measure aspects of the patient experience. Data sources Four databases were searched from inception to December 20th, 2019. Review methods Systematic or scoping reviews examining patient experience in seeking care for musculoskeletal from healthcare providers and the healthcare system were included. Independent authors screened and selected studies, extracted data, and assessed the methodological quality of the reviews. Patient experience concepts were compiled into five themes from a perspective of a) relational and b) functional aspects. A list of mechanisms used to capture the patient experience was also collected. Results Thirty reviews were included (18 systematic and 12 scoping reviews). Relational aspects were reported in 29 reviews and functional aspects in 25 reviews. For relational aspects, the most prevalent themes were “information needs” (education and explanation on diseases, symptoms, and self-management strategies) and “understanding patient expectations” (respect and empathy). For functional aspects, the most prevalent themes were patient’s “physical and environmental needs,” (cleanliness, safety, and accessibility of clinics), and “trusted expertise,” (healthcare providers’ competence and clinical skills to provide holistic care). Interviews were the most frequent mechanism identified to collect patient experience. Conclusions Measuring patient experience provides direct insights about the patient’s perspectives and may help to promote better patient-centered health services and increase the quality of care. Areas of improvement identified were interpersonal skills of healthcare providers and logistics of health delivery, which may lead to a more desirable patient-perceived experience and thus better overall healthcare outcomes. Domingues L, Pimentel-Santos FM, Cruz EB, Sousa AC, Santos A, Cordovil A, Correia A, Torres LS, Silva A, Branco PS, Branco JC. Is a combined programme of manual therapy and exercise more effective than usual care in patients with non-specific chronic neck pain? A randomized controlled trial. Clin Rehabil 2019; 33:1908-1918. [PMID: 31549519 DOI: 10.1177/0269215519876675]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/26/2022]
Abstract
OBJECTIVE The aim of this study was to compare the effectiveness of a combined intervention of manual therapy and exercise (MET) versus usual care (UC), on disability, pain intensity and global perceived recovery, in patients with non-specific chronic neck pain (CNP). DESIGN Randomized controlled trial. SETTING Outpatient care units. SUBJECTS Sixty-four non-specific CNP patients were randomly allocated to MET (n = 32) or UC (n = 32) groups. INTERVENTIONS Participants in the MET group received 12 sessions of mobilization and exercise, whereas the UC group received 15 sessions of usual care in physiotherapy. MAIN MEASURES The primary outcome was disability (Neck Disability Index). The secondary outcomes were pain intensity (Numeric Pain Rating Scale) and global perceived recovery (Patient Global Impression Change). Patients were assessed at baseline, three weeks, six weeks (end of treatment) and at a three-month follow-up. RESULTS Fifty-eight participants completed the study. No significant between-group difference was observed on disability and pain intensity at baseline. A significant between-group difference was observed on disability at three-week, six-week and three-month follow-up (median (P25-P75): 6 (3.25-9.81) vs. 15.5 (11.28-20.75); P < 0.001), favouring the MET group. Regarding pain intensity, a significant between-group difference was observed at six-week and three-month follow-up (median (P25-P75): 2 (1-2.51) vs. 5 (3.33-6); P < 0.001), with superiority of effect in MET group. Concerning the global perceived recovery, a significant between-group difference was observed only at the three-month follow-up (P = 0.001), favouring the MET group. CONCLUSION This study's findings suggest that a combination of manual therapy and exercise is more effective than usual care on disability, pain intensity and global perceived recovery.

Tsang SMH, So BCL, Lau RWL, Dai J, Szeto GPY. Comparing the effectiveness of integrating ergonomics and motor control to conventional treatment for pain and functional recovery of work-related neck-shoulder pain: A randomized trial. Eur J Pain 2019; 23:1141-1152. [PMID: 30793422 DOI: 10.1002/ejp.1381]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/18/2018] [Revised: 01/26/2019] [Accepted: 02/17/2019] [Indexed: 11/11/2022]
Abstract
BACKGROUND Work-related neck and shoulder pain (WRNSP) is highly prevalent among patients who seek physiotherapy treatment. Clinicians may tend to focus on teaching home exercises and provide general advice about workplace improvement. The present study investigates the short- and long-term impact of an intervention approach that emphasizes on integrating the motor control re-education with ergonomic advice. METHODS Participants diagnosed with WRNSP (n = 101) were randomly assigned into two groups in this randomized controlled trial. The Ergo-motor Group (EM, n = 51) received an integrated intervention with ergonomic advice/modifications and motor control training individualized for each participant based on their specific work demands. Control Group (CO, n = 50) received treatment for pain relief and general exercises of their necks at a designated physiotherapy clinic. Neck pain intensity and functional outcome measures were assessed before, immediately and 1-year after the 12-week intervention programmes. Global Rating of Change Score was used to evaluate the perceived recovery at 1-year follow-up. RESULTS Both groups reported significant reductions in pain and functional disability scores at post-intervention (EM, n = 44; CO, n = 42) and 1-year follow-up (EM, n = 40; CO, n = 38); however, no significant between-group differences were found (p > 0.05). Significantly higher rating in global recovery score was reported in EM group at 1-year follow-up (p < 0.05). CONCLUSIONS Intervention integrating ergonomic advice/modification with motor control exercise was found to be equally effective as pain relief and general exercise for pain and functional recovery. However, at 1-year follow-up, such integrated approach resulted in significantly better global recovery perceived by people with WRNSP. SIGNIFICANCE Integrating ergonomic intervention and motor control training achieved similar reduction in pain and functional outcomes compared to conventional physiotherapy at post-intervention and at 1-year follow-up, for patients with moderate level of work-related neck-shoulder pain and mild degree of functional disability. The Ergo-motor Group reported significantly better perceived overall recovery at 1-year follow-up.

Svedmark Å, Björklund M, Häger CK, Sommar JN, Wahlström J. Impact of Workplace Exposure and Stress on Neck Pain and Disabilities in Women-A Longitudinal Follow-up After a Rehabilitation Intervention. Ann Work Expo Health 2018; 62:591-603. [PMID: 29562318 DOI: 10.1093/annweh/wxy018]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/16/2017] [Accepted: 02/21/2018] [Indexed: 11/13/2022] Open
Abstract
Introduction The aim was to evaluate if pain, disability, and work productivity are influenced by physical and psychosocial work exposures as well as by stress, up to 1 year after a randomized controlled trial treatment intervention, and to determine whether any such association differed between treatment and control groups. Methods Ninety-seven working women suffering non-specific neck pain (n = 67 treatment group, n = 30 control group) were followed from end of treatment intervention and at 9- and 15-month follow-ups, respectively. Physical and psychosocial exposures, as well as perceived stress, were assessed after the treatment intervention. Pain, neck disability, and work productivity were assessed at baseline, after intervention 3 months later and at 9- and 15-month follow-ups. Longitudinal assessment was conducted using the exposure level at 3 months as predictor of pain, disability, and work productivity at 3, 9, and 15 months, respectively. Mixed models were used to estimate longitudinal associations, accounting for within-individual correlation of repeated outcome measures by incorporation of a random intercept. Age and duration of neck pain were adjusted for in all models. To evaluate group differences, interactions between exposures and treatment groups were estimated. Results High perceived stress was associated with more neck pain, more neck disability, and decreased work productivity in both cross-sectional and longitudinal analyses. High 'control of decision' was associated with less neck pain, less neck disability, and higher work productivity in cross-sectional analyses but only to less disability and higher productivity in longitudinal analyses. Shoulder/arm load was the only physical exposure variable that was significantly associated with work productivity in the univariate analyses. Only small differences were observed between treatment and control groups. Conclusion High perceived stress and low 'control of decision' were associated with more neck pain, increased neck disability, and decreased work productivity. Treatment interventions for individuals with neck pain should take into account psychosocial workplace exposures and stress to improve intermediate and long-term results.

Sá S, Silva AG. Repositioning error, pressure pain threshold, catastrophizing and anxiety in adolescents with chronic idiopathic neck pain. Musculoskelet Sci Pract 2017; 30:18-24. [PMID: 28494262 DOI: 10.1016/j.msksp.2017.04.011] [Citation(s) in RCA: 35] [Impact Index Per Article: 5.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/05/2016] [Revised: 04/06/2017] [Accepted: 04/29/2017] [Indexed: 11/27/2022]
Abstract
BACKGROUND Impaired proprioception, increased pain sensitivity, higher levels of anxiety and catastrophizing are present in adults with chronic idiopathic neck pain. Despite the high prevalence of neck pain, studies in adolescents are scarce. OBJECTIVES The main aim was to compare pressure pain thresholds (PPTs) and joint repositioning error (JRE) between adolescents with chronic idiopathic neck pain and adolescents without neck pain. Secondary aims were to compare these groups for catastrophizing and anxiety and to investigate the association between PPTs, JRE and psychosocial variables and pain characteristics. METHODS 80 adolescents (40 with and 40 without chronic neck pain) were assessed for: neck repositioning error, neck, upper trapezius and tibialis anterior PPTs, anxiety and catastrophizing. Neck pain was characterized in terms of intensity, frequency, duration and associated disability. MANCOVA was used for between group comparisons and Pearson and Spearman coefficients for correlational analysis. RESULTS Adolescents with neck pain showed higher levels of catastrophizing (p < 0.001) and anxiety (trait: p < 0.001; state: p = 0.028), lower PPTs (p < 0.001) and higher JRE (p < 0.001) than asymptomatic controls. Pain intensity, frequency and duration were moderately correlated with anxiety, and disability was moderately correlated with anxiety (r between 0.43 and 0.50, p < 0.05) and catastrophizing (r = 0.40, p < 0.05). CONCLUSIONS This study suggests that functional changes and maladaptive cognitive processes are present in adolescents with neck pain aged 16-18 years old. These findings need to be replicated in future studies.
